Question: Has there been a change in toolbox location?

Currently I have Maple versions 2023,2025, and 2026 installed on Windows 11. Today I installed a workbook package containing a module that I just completed using the PackageTools installer in Maple 2026.. To my surprise, I found that a package installed from Maple 2026 was also available in Maple 2023 and, conversely, a package installed in Maple 2023 was automatically available in Maple 2026. i noticed that, with the exception of the Maple Customer Support Updates, the toolbox directory is no longer broken down by versions. I also noticed that the directory containing the module installed by Maple 2026 was named by the workbook instead of the module name (ie. hopfwords.maple). As I recall, the toolboxes used to be version dependent. 

The question is to what extent can one assume that a package created in Maple 2026 will be compatible with at least the more recent versions of Maple, I am also wondering why the directory name is now the workbook name instead of the module name.
